关于#kubernetes#的问题:上下文切换问题 Context

k8s 切换环境问题:切过去之后,怎么切回来呢?
先创建了个集群和两个环境
kubectl config set-cluster k8s-cluster --server=https://192.168.134.135:8080/
kubectl config set-context ctx-dev --namespace=development --cluster=k8s-cluster --user=dev
kubectl config set-context ctx-prod --namespace=production --cluster=k8s-cluster --user=prod

kubectl config view

apiVersion: v1
clusters:
- cluster:
    server: https://192.168.134.135:8080
  name: k8s-cluster
contexts:
- context:
    cluster: k8s-cluster
    namespace: development
    user: dev
  name: ctx-dev
- context:
    cluster: k8s-cluster
    namespace: production
    user: prod
  name: ctx-prod
current-context: ctx-dev
kind: Config
preferences: {}
users: null

把当前工作环境设置为 ctx-dev 
kubectl config use-context ctx-dev
想切换回原来的,然后就不知道咋切换回去了
查看node 状态  提示输入账号和密码

![img](https://img-mid.csdnimg.cn/release/static/image/mid/ask/085272785786137.png "#left")

在 Kubernetes 中,你可以使用 kubectl config use-context 命令来切换上下文。在你的例子中,你已经将当前上下文设置为 ctx-dev。如果你想切换回 ctx-prod,你可以运行以下命令:

kubectl config use-context ctx-prod

这将把你的当前上下文切换回 ctx-prod

如果你忘记了你的上下文名称,你可以使用 kubectl config get-contexts 命令来查看所有的上下文。这将显示一个列表,包括每个上下文的名称、集群、命名空间和用户。你可以从这个列表中找到你想切换到的上下文的名称。

如果你想查看你当前的上下文,你可以使用 kubectl config current-context 命令。这将显示你当前的上下文名称。